Best World War 2 books with true stories?
2 answers
2024-12-08 18:05
A good one is 'Schindler's List' in book form. It details the true story of Oskar Schindler, a German businessman who saved the lives of many Jews. 'The Rape of Nanking' is also a significant book. It reveals the brutal and often - overlooked true story of the Nanking Massacre during World War 2. Then there's 'Maus' which uses a unique graphic novel format to tell the true story of the author's father's experiences in the Holocaust.
Most famous World War 2 books with true stories?
1 answer
2024-12-09 08:09
Among the most famous is 'Night' by Elie Wiesel. His harrowing account of the concentration camps has had a profound impact on the world's understanding of the Holocaust. 'The Longest Day' is also well - known for its detailed and comprehensive coverage of D - Day, which is one of the most important events in World War 2 history.
Recommend some World War 2 books with marines' true stories.
2 answers
2024-12-10 23:48
One great book is 'With the Old Breed' by E. B. Sledge. It vividly recounts his experiences as a marine in the Pacific theater during World War 2. Sledge's detailed descriptions of combat, the harsh conditions, and the camaraderie among the marines make it a must - read for those interested in real - life war stories.
What are some World War 2 books based on true stories?
2 answers
2024-12-05 06:21
One great book is 'The Diary of a Young Girl' by Anne Frank. It tells the true story of a young Jewish girl hiding from the Nazis during the war. Another is 'Unbroken' by Laura Hillenbrand, which is about Louis Zamperini, an Olympic athlete who endured incredible hardships as a prisoner of war. Also, 'Band of Brothers' by Stephen E. Ambrose, which follows the real - life experiences of a company of American soldiers in World War 2.
